Quick and Flavorful Sautéed Mushrooms
If you're looking for a quick and delicious way to elevate your meals, sautéed mushrooms are a fantastic choice. This simple yet savory dish combines the earthy flavors of mushrooms with aromatic garlic and fresh herbs, all enhanced by a splash of white wine. Ready in less than 15 minutes, this versatile recipe can serve as a side dish, a topping for grilled steak, or a delightful addition to your favorite pasta.
To get started, gather your ingredients: fresh mushrooms (like cremini or button mushrooms), garlic, olive oil, fresh herbs (such as parsley or thyme), and a splash of white wine. The key to achieving the perfect sauté lies in the temperature and technique. Begin by heating a generous amount of ol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once the oil is hot, add the sliced mushrooms in a single layer, ensuring not to overcrowd the pan. This allows them to brown beautifully, enhancing their natural flavors.
After a few minutes, when the mushrooms start to turn golden, add minced garlic and your choice of herbs. Stir frequently to prevent the garlic from burning. The aroma will be irresistible! For an extra layer of flavor, deglaze the pan with a splash of white wine, scraping up any delicious bits stuck to the bottom. This not only adds depth but also infuses the mushrooms with a delightful tang.
Once the wine has reduced and the mushrooms are tender and flavorful, season with salt and pepper to taste. Serve your sautéed mushrooms warm, either on their own, over a juicy steak, or tossed into pasta for a hearty meal. Easy Mushroom Risotto: A Creamy Comfort in No Time
If you’re looking for a quick yet indulgent dish that brings the cozy vibes of Italian cuisine to your kitchen, look no further than this easy mushroom risotto. With its creamy texture and rich flavor, this dish not only satisfies your taste buds but also impresses your family or guests—all in just 25 minutes.
The key to a perfect risotto lies in the arborio rice, a short-grain rice that absorbs liquid and releases starch, creating that coveted creamy consistency. When paired with fresh, sautéed mushrooms, this dish becomes a true delight. Plus, the addition of Parmesan cheese elevates the flavor profile, making every bite a savory experience.
To start, gather your ingredients: 1 cup of arborio rice, 4 cups of vegetable or chicken broth, 1 cup of fresh mushrooms (such as cremini or shiitake), 1 small onion, 2 cloves of garlic, ½ cup of white wine, and ½ cup of grated Parmesan cheese. Fresh herbs like parsley or thyme can also add a lovely touch at the end.
Begin by heating the broth in a saucepan over low heat; keep it warm but not boiling. In a separate large skillet, add a tablespoon of olive oil and sauté the finely chopped onion until translucent. Then, add minced garlic and sliced mushrooms, cooking until the mushrooms are tender and browned. This step is crucial as it develops the dish's foundation of flavor.
Next, add the arborio rice to the skillet, stirring for about 2 minutes until it’s lightly toasted. The rice should begin to look translucent. Pour in the white wine and let it simmer until absorbed. This not only contributes acidity but also enhances the overall depth of flavor.
Now it’s time to incorporate the broth—add it one ladle at a time, stirring frequently. Allow the rice to absorb the liquid before adding more. This technique helps release the starch from the rice, ensuring a creamy texture. After about 18-20 minutes, when the rice is al dente, stir in the grated Parmesan cheese and season with salt and pepper to taste. For an extra touch, sprinkle with fresh herbs before serving.
This easy mushroom risotto is incredibly versatile; feel free to add in other vegetables like peas or spinach, or even proteins like chicken or shrimp for a heartier meal. Mushroom-Stuffed Avocado: A Nutritious Delight
If you’re looking for a fresh and innovative way to enjoy your vegetables, mushroom-stuffed avocado is a perfect choice. This dish not only pleases the palate but also packs a nutritional punch, making it an excellent option for lunch or a light dinner. With a preparation time of under 30 minutes, you can whip up this satisfying meal in no time.
To start, gather your ingredients: ripe avocados, fresh mushrooms, garlic, onion, and your choice of spices. For added flavor, consider using herbs like thyme or parsley, and don’t forget a sprinkle of lemon juice to enhance the freshness and prevent the avocados from browning.
Begin by heating a skillet over medium heat. Add a drizzle of olive oil, and sauté finely chopped onions and minced garlic until they become fragrant and translucent. This step is crucial as it builds the foundation of flavor for your stuffed avocados.
Next, incorporate your chopped mushrooms into the pan. Varieties like cremini or button mushrooms work wonderfully, but feel free to explore different types based on your preference. Sauté the mushrooms for about 5-7 minutes until they are golden brown and tender. This not only enhances their flavor but also reduces moisture, preventing your filling from becoming soggy.
Once the mushrooms are cooked, season them with salt, pepper, and your chosen herbs. For a bit of heat, consider adding red pepper flakes. Remove the pan from the heat and allow the mixture to cool slightly while you prepare the avocados.
Cut the avocados in half and carefully remove the pit. You can scoop out a little of the flesh to create a larger cavity for the mushroom filling if desired. Spoon the savory mushroom mixture into each avocado half,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ully. For an extra touch, top with crumbled feta cheese or a dollop of Greek yogurt.
This mushroom-stuffed avocado dish is not only visually appealing but also provides healthy fats and vital nutrients. Avocados are rich in fiber, potassium, and vitamins C, E, and K, while mushrooms are a fantastic source of B vitamins and antioxidants. Together, they create a balanced meal that is both satisfying and nutritious.
Serve your stuffed avocados immediately, garnished with fresh herbs or a drizzle of balsamic glaze for added pizzazz.
